The Week in Review from Valeo Financial Advisors (May 3, 2013)
U.S. Economy
- Corporate profits after tax relative to the size of the U.S. economy hit a 65 year high at the end of last year. Chart: Valeo Financial Advisors
- U.S. consumer confidence jumps to 68.1 in April on better outlook for hiring and expectations for higher pay. CNBC
- The Case-Shiller home-price index up 9.3% from a year ago year over year growth is highest since 2006 MarketWatch
Unemployment
- Payrolls in U.S. rise 165,000 as unemployment drops to 7.5%, the lowest rate since December 2008 Bloomberg
- Spring 2010 unemployment rates in U.S. & the euro zone were nearly the same at about 10%. Now U.S.=7.5% Europe=12.1% The Economist
- Euro-area jobless rate rises to record 12.1% in March | Bloomberg
